818842 Hong Kong Races in 1876 (engraving) by English School, (19th century); Private Collection; (add.info.: Hong Kong Races in 1876. A sketch in the crowd. Published in The Graphic on 29 July 1876.); Look and Learn / Elgar Collection

Hong Kong Races in 1876 - A Glimpse into the Vibrant Horse Racing Culture of the Past
EDITORS COMMENTS
. This photo print, titled "Hong Kong Races in 1876" takes us back to a bygone era when horse racing was at its peak. The engraving, created by an anonymous English School artist from the 19th century, offers a fascinating glimpse into this thrilling sporting event. The image showcases a bustling scene filled with spectators eagerly watching the races unfold. Amidst the crowd, one can spot a sketch artist capturing the excitement on paper – a testament to how these races captivated people's imaginations even then. The Hong Kong Races were not just about horses; they represented an amalgamation of cultures and nationalities. From Chinese locals to Europeans hailing from Germany and France, everyone came together to witness these exhilarating contests. The presence of various horse breeds like Shire horses and ponies adds further diversity to this snapshot of equestrian excellence.
